Key responsibilities include:

  • Relationship Building: Cultivate and maintain partnerships with community groups, local businesses, and corporate supporters to generate income through donations, volunteering, and sponsorships.
  • Campaigns & Events: Collaborate with the Head of Fundraising to plan and execute creative campaigns and events that engage supporters and boost the charities profile and revenue.
  • Social Media Management: Work with the Communications Officer to produce engaging content, manage social media channels, and explore new ways to connect with potential donors.

Additional Responsibilities:

  • Fundraising Enquiries: Serve as the primary contact for community and corporate fundraising queries.
  • Corporate Portfolio Management: Build and manage a pipeline of corporate contacts through research and outreach.
  • Presentations & Networking: Confidently pitch to and network with corporate and community groups, enhancing the charities profile and securing new opportunities.
  • Supporter Experience: Ensure positive engagement with supporters through tailored donor journeys.
  • Event & Campaign Delivery: Execute fundraising events and campaigns across all income streams to meet set targets.
  • Media & Communications Support: Assist with press releases, photo calls, and media appearances to promote fundraising activities.
  • CRM Management: Maintain accurate donor records and fundraising activities using CRM software.
